Students with Three Types of Severe Reading Disabilities: Introduction to the Case Studies.
Felton, Rebecca H.
Journal of Special Education, v35 n3 p122-24 Fall 2001
This introductory article to a special issue of case studies shows the diversity of students with severe reading disabilities. It notes that poor readers often have difficulties in one or more of three areas: decoding, recognizing words automatically, and reading text fluently, all linked to weaknesses in rapid naming of visually presented items.
